Tesseract: The Shape of 4D
Imagine a world surpassing our three familiar dimensions. In this realm, objects assume shapes we can barely comprehend. The tesseract, a four-dimensional cube, serves as a gateway to this extraordinary territory.
Imagine a cube, the most fundamental 3D form. Now, project its dimensions into a fourth, unseeable direction. This yields a shape with eight three-dimensional cubes interlocked together.
This fascinating object, the tesseract, defies our intuitive understanding of space and shape. It offers a glimpse into the possibilities of higher dimensions, sparking our imagination to explore the unseen.
